Invisible Girl

It wasn’t easy being married to the Invisible Girl.

You’d think that spending your life with a superhero would be bliss, but it’s tough washing bloodstains out of invisible clothes. True, we only ever had to buy single tickets for the cinema, but often when I went to hold her hand I’d be left grasping at air.

When she finally left me I didn’t notice for a week. Superheroes, it seems, don’t need significant others.
